About Converting Grains per Imperial gallon to Grains per Teaspoon
Grain per Imperial gallon and Grain per Teaspoon both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Formula
grains per teaspoon = grains per imperial gallon × 0.0010842111779
This factor comes from each unit's defined relationship to the category's base unit: 1 grain per imperial gallon equals 0.0142537675233 base units, and 1 grain per teaspoon equals 13.1466708828 base units, so dividing one by the other gives the direct grain per imperial gallon-to-grain per teaspoon factor of 0.0010842111779.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
